Our Story: Gentle Support After Unexpected Sudden Loss
Hi, I’m Salina, the creator of Forever Dhian.
In October 2024, my world shattered when I suffered the sudden loss of my beautiful, healthy son, Dhian, just days before his first birthday. In the wake of that unimaginable pain, I searched desperately for resources that understood the unique weight of sudden loss—the shock, the unanswered questions, the loneliness in a world that moves forward when yours has stopped.
What I needed most was gentle guidance, not clichés. Practical tools, not platitudes. A space where grief wasn’t fixed, but honored.
Before Dhian’s passing, I ran a small Etsy shop creating digital invitations and family planners (which can be found [here]). While that work brought me joy, it was his loss that reshaped my purpose. The care I poured into those 5-star-reviewed products—the attention to detail, the quiet hope that my work might ease someone’s load—is now channeled into every grief guide, every journal prompt I create here. This isn’t just a shop. It’s a lifeline I needed but couldn’t find.
That’s why I created Forever Dhian.
